Kim Kardashian, Kanye West welcome their fourth child

NEW YORK

Kim Kardashian West and Kanye West have welcomed their fourth child, a boy born via surrogate.

Kardashian West tweeted Friday: “He’s here and he’s perfect!” A spokeswoman said in an email the baby was born Thursday, weighing in at 6 pounds, 9 ounces.

The new baby joins North, Saint and Chicago. Chicago, who’s a year and a half, also was born via a gestational carrier. North, the oldest, is 5. The new baby is the couple’s second son after Saint.

Kardashian West later tweeted the new arrival is “Chicago’s twin lol I’m sure he will change a lot but now he looks just like her.”

The birth comes after she disclosed she’s studying to be a lawyer through California rules that allow for professional mentorship over law school.

Former Fugees rapper charged in campaign finance case

WASHINGTON

One of the founding members of the 1990s hip-hop group the Fugees has been charged in a campaign finance conspiracy that took place during the 2012 U.S. presidential election, the Justice Department said Friday.

A four-count indictment accuses Prakazrel “Pras” Michel of conspiring with fugitive Malaysian financer Jho Low to make and conceal foreign campaign contributions. He is alleged to have used straw donors to give campaign contributions to a presidential candidate, who is identified in the indictment only as Candidate A.

“Mr. Michel is extremely disappointed that so many years after the fact the government would bring charges related to 2012 campaign contributions,” said defense lawyer Barry Pollack. “Mr. Michel is innocent of these charges and looks forward to having the case heard by a jury.”
